My mom is messaging my boyfriend on facebook!? What should I do?
My mom has been sending my boyfriend MANY messages on facebook (will send 5 at a time) with information about colleges, financial aid, etc. I understand she is trying to be helpful but it is embarassing and way too much. Am I right to think this is not okay? What can I say to help her understand it really bothers me?!
